Similarly one may ask, what are all of the domain extensions?

Types

  • infrastructure top-level domain (ARPA)
  • generic top-level domains (gTLD)
  • generic-restricted top-level domains (grTLD)
  • sponsored top-level domains (sTLD)
  • country code top-level domains (ccTLD)
  • test top-level domains (tTLD)

Do .com domains rank higher?

In other words, .com domains do not rank higher in search due to their TLD. However, they might indirectly rank higher due to Google's preference for aged brands. An aged brand is a website or company with a long track record of quality content, frequent updates, and technical uptime.

Is .INT a domain name extension?

int domain is a specialized domain offering registrations solely to intergovernmental organisations. In brief, the . int domain is used for registering organisations established by international treaties between or among national governments. Only one registration is allowed for each organisation.

What is top level domain name?

A top-level domain (TLD) is one of the domains at the highest level in the hierarchical Domain Name System of the Internet. The top-level domain names are installed in the root zone of the name space. For example, in the domain name the top-level domain is com.

What is .ICU domain?

icu domain registrations are open to the public. . icu, shorthand for "I See You," is a new extension designed to provide an easy, innovative, and universal alternative to traditional domains. The extension already has over 100 registrars in more than 30 countries signed up to distribute the names to end users.

What are the 3 types of domain?

There are three domains of life, the Archaea, the Bacteria, and the Eucarya. Organisms from Archaea and Bacteria have a prokaryotic cell structure, whereas organisms from the domain Eucarya (eukaryotes) encompass cells with a nucleus confining the genetic material from the cytoplasm.

Can I create my own domain extension?

3 Answers. You can't. Only IANA can. Management of most top-level domains is delegated to responsible organizations by the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N), which operates the Internet Assigned Numbers Authority (IANA) and is in charge of maintaining the DNS root zone.

What are valid email extensions?

A valid email address consists of an email prefix and an email domain, both in acceptable formats. The prefix appears to the left of the @ symbol. The domain appears to the right of the @ symbol. For example, in the address example@mail.com, "example" is the email prefix, and "mail.com" is the email domain.

What is second level domain name?

A second-level domain is the part of a domain name or website address that comes before the top-level domain (tld). Ex: In janesmith. realtor, “janesmith” is the second-level domain and . realtor™ is the tld.
